Output 61c7f63939ae2b73d508e791fbd3f35aecf202c75a76fec6d6832c16dada0146:12

value
27583440
script pubkey
OP_0 OP_PUSHBYTES_20 04882541fdc60a4ad03af5adc06059a4cd13bbbe
address
bc1qqjyz2s0acc9y45p67kkuqcze5nx38wa7juwwd2
transaction
61c7f63939ae2b73d508e791fbd3f35aecf202c75a76fec6d6832c16dada0146
confirmations
103702
spent
true